    Abstract: The present invention relates to a performance evaluation system constructed to efficiently collect and accumulate analysis conditions for use in three dimensional model analysis. The performance evaluation system 50 is constructed by connecting a plurality of performance evaluation apparatuses 1 provided in each machine tool to a management apparatus 52 via a network 51. Each performance evaluation apparatus 1 comprises an analysis data storing section 12 in which model data and condition data are stored, a detecting device 4 which detects actual performance, an analyzing section 13 which analyzes the performance, an evaluation determining section 15 which evaluates the correctness of the analyzed performance data, and a data updating section 16 which changes and updates the model data and the condition data. The management apparatus 52 comprises an analysis data accumulating section 61 which accumulates the model data and condition data received from the performance evaluation apparatus 1.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to an offset apparatus for an NC machine tool, that can achieve high accuracy machining by offsetting the amount of operation of a motion mechanism in accordance with the analysis result of the behavior of the NC machine tool. The offset apparatus 1 comprises: a model analyzing data base 12 in which three dimensional model data of the motion mechanism 2 and condition data for performance analysis are stored; a model analyzing section 13 which analyzes the performance of the motion mechanism 2; a data accumulating section 14 which stores analyzed performance analysis data; an offset amount computing section 15 which computes an offset amount to be applied to a commanded operation amount on the basis of the performance analysis data; and an offset executing section 17 which offsets the amount of operation of the motion mechanism 2 on the basis of the offset amount.

    Abstract: The present invention provides an NC machine tool which permits a check for the run-out of a spindle thereof at any time. The NC machine tool includes deflection detecting means (22) provided on a base within a machining area, and run-out diagnosing means (8) for conducting a diagnosis on the run-out of the spindle by calculating the amount of the run-out of the spindle on the basis of a deflection detected by the deflection detecting means (22) and comparing the calculated run-out amount with a predetermined tolerance. A test tool is attached to the spindle and rotated about an axis thereof, and the deflection of an outer circumferential surface of the test tool is detected by the deflection detecting means (22). On the basis of the deflection thus detected, the run-out diagnosing means (8) conducts a diagnosis on the run-out of the spindle.

    Abstract: The present invention provides a maintenance system, which centrally performs a management operation on the life expectancies of expendable components of machine tools (21) provided in a plant for systematic maintenance of the machine tools (21). The maintenance system comprises a plurality of machine tools (21) and a management unit (20) connected to the machine tools (21). The management unit (20) comprises: a life expectancy determining section (92) for determining the degrees of wear of driver mechanisms on the basis of data indicative of the operating conditions of the driver mechanisms received from a controller (80) provided in each of the machine tools (21); a data storage section (91) for storing data indicative of the wear degrees determined by the life expectancy determining section (92), and an output section (93, 95) for outputting information on the wear degrees stored in the data storage section (91).

    Abstract: The present invention provides an automatic tool changer which is adapted to detect the end of the service life of a bearing of a cam follower for systematic replacement of the bearing. The automatic tool changer comprises: a tool changer mechanism (26) including a rotation shaft, a changer arm fixed to the rotation shaft, a cam follower attached to the rotation shaft and having an engagement roller rotatably supported by a bearing, a cam engaged with the engagement roller of the cam follower, and drive for driving the cam; and a controlling section (57) for controlling an operation of the tool changer mechanism (26). The tool changer further comprises a service life end detecting section (9) for counting the number of times of the operation performed by the tool changer mechanism (26) and judging whether or not the count of the number reaches a reference operation number serving as a basis for the detection of the end of the service life of the bearing.

    Abstract: The present invention provides a machine tool which is adapted to detect the end of the service life of a spring of a clamp unit for fixing a tool to a spindle for systematic replacement of the spring. The machine tool comprises a clamp unit (47) for fixing a tool in a taper hole provided in a spindle, and a controlling section (63) for controlling the operation of the clamp unit. The clamp unit (47) includes a holder for holding a holder portion of the tool, a driving rod coupled to the holder, a driver for moving the driving rod along an axis thereof, and a spring for biasing the driving rod in one direction along the axis thereof. The machine tool further comprises a service life end detecting section (11) for counting the number of times of actuation of the clamp unit (47) and, when the count of the number reaches a predetermined reference actuation number, judging that the service life of the spring ends.
